Which of the following has the highest Boiling Point?
Chloromethane
Fluoromethane
Bromomethane
Iodomethane
Iodomethane
Solution
The correct option is (D): Iodomethane.
The boiling point of a compound is influenced by various factors, including the strength and nature of intermolecular forces. In this case, we can compare the compounds based on the polarity and strength of the halogen bonding.
Among the given compounds, the polarity and intermolecular forces increase in the order: Fluoromethane (B) < Chloromethane (A) < Bromomethane (C) < Iodomethane (D)
As we move down the halogen group, the size and polarizability of the halogen atoms increase. Larger halogen atoms induce stronger van der Waals forces, resulting in higher boiling points.
Therefore, Iodomethane (D) is expected to have the highest boiling point among the given compounds.
